PS3 PKG games are essentially game files that have been packaged in a format that can be easily installed and played on a PS3 console. These files usually contain the game's data, including the executable code, graphics, soundtracks, and other necessary files. PKG files are typically used for digital distribution on the PlayStation Store, but they can also be obtained from other sources.

To run PKG files on a real PS3, your console must be modified (jailbroken) with either or HEN (Homebrew ENabler) .
It cannot handle individual files larger than 4GB. Because many high-quality PS3 PKG games exceed 4GB, you must use an NTFS or exFAT formatted USB drive alongside a file manager plugin like irisMAN or prepISO to copy files to the internal hard drive ( dev_hdd0 ).
